Output 16d909277e858d9613e0d9f07df00d7bfd7cc3fc9549450e539e7f75c1b7f3fd:0

value
5308523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22070d31e351167a6048ce5e179bf99e29f143b2 OP_EQUAL
address
34nwM1sEUFEPTQ2yparXvPhq3Bk5gEmVqw
transaction
16d909277e858d9613e0d9f07df00d7bfd7cc3fc9549450e539e7f75c1b7f3fd
spent
true